Judicial probe into custodial death

GAUTAM SARKAR IN JAMUI Published 05.07.13, 12:00 AM

First class judicial magistrate Shyamal Kumar, assigned to conduct a judicial inquiry into Munna Singh’s custodial death on July 1, assumed office on Thursday.

On July 3, Jamui district and sessions judge Jyoti Srivastava had ordered a judicial inquiry into Munna’s death in Patna Medical College and Hospital (PMCH). The Jamui chief judicial magistrate, Dayalal Prasad, had assigned Shyamal for the probe and asked him to submit a report within a fortnight.

On July 2, the superintendent of Jamui district jail, Anil Kumar Mishra, had in a letter to Prasad alleged third degree torture by the police and the subsequent death of the accused. Jitendar Rana, a 2005-batch IPS officer, who has taken over as the Jamui superintendent of police (SP), said a speedy trial would be conducted. He said a special team has been constituted to arrest the accused — station house officers Jitendra Kumar and Satyavrat Bharti of Jamui Town and Giddhaur police stations, respectively, and then Jamui SP Barnawal’s bodyguard.

“The team has started raiding different places and we are establishing contact with the police of the home districts of the accused,” he said.
